I'd say that DevOps Engineer builds things until those things are on fire. SRE are like fire department.

I love that description of it. Also, it’s really difficult to say from company to company. Sometimes DevOps engineers were sysadmins in a past life and sometimes were software engineers.

But the way you put it is kinda how I see it now. Initially it was pretty difficult for me to distinguish a true difference between the two. The job functions can be very similar.